Meaning of Hidee Hidee Ho #11 by Bob Dylan

In Bob Dylan's song "Hidee Hidee Ho #11," he takes the listener on a poetic journey through unexpected themes and imaginative narratives. The overall theme of the song appears to revolve around a romantic encounter that starts off innocently but becomes increasingly complex and potentially dangerous. Dylan weaves a captivating tale of love and intrigue, using his distinct lyrical style to evoke emotion and curiosity.One standout lyric in the song is, "How could she suspect me of leading her astray?" This lyric hints at the idea of deception and the struggle to maintain trust in a relationship. The theme it develops revolves around the fragility of trust and the potential for misunderstandings that can lead to a breakdown in a relationship.Another intriguing lyric is, "I took out my pen knife and showed it at this rake." This line introduces an element of danger and hints at potential violence. It develops the theme of hidden aggression within relationships, implying that even seemingly innocent encounters can have underlying tension and conflict.Dylan's repetition of the phrase "Hidee hidee ho" throughout the song adds a playful tone to an otherwise serious narrative. This repetition develops a theme of secrecy and hidden desires. The phrase portrays a sense of excitement and adventure, suggesting that the characters in the song are indulging in a secret romance and enjoying the thrill of it.The lyric, "making love wherever we go," reveals a theme of spontaneity and rebellion against societal norms. It suggests a disregard for conventional rules and a desire to live life on their own terms. This theme explores the idea of embracing freedom and indulging in passion without hesitations or restrictions.Dylan's imagery of "making love in a pile of rope" and "making love on the driveway ramp" adds an element of the unexpected. These imaginative scenarios develop a theme of unconventional intimacy and a lust for thrill-seeking experiences. It suggests that the characters in the song are driven by a desire for excitement and are unafraid to push boundaries in pursuit of their desires.Ultimately, the song "Hidee Hidee Ho #11" presents a multi-layered exploration of themes such as trust, hidden aggression, secrecy, rebellion, and unconventional intimacy. Dylan's poetic lyrics and evocative imagery draw the listener into a world where love and danger intersect, leaving ample room for interpretation and reflection. Through his imaginative storytelling, Dylan invites us to delve into the complexities of relationships and the intricate emotions that accompany them.
